WebFox English From the name of the animal. It was originally a nickname for a person with red hair or a crafty person. Fuchs German From Old High German fuhs meaning "fox". It was originally a nickname for a person with red hair. Gagnon French Derived from old French gagnon "guard dog". WebFOX Genealogy.
